用TNT的{D,ρ0}实验数据对爆轰的ZND理论的检验

摘    要:爆轰产物中或多或少含有固态碳,一相的排平物态方程被推广为两相的之后,以某种炸药的一条已知等熵线为参考曲线,就可以用来估算其各种初始装药密度下的爆轰参数.用产物中含碳量较多的TNT的{D,ρ0}实验数据与理论估算值相比较,可以对爆轰的ZND理论的假设进行检验.检验的结果再一次表明,爆轰的ZND理论的假设是成立的,并且排平物态方程是恰当的爆轰产物的物态方程.

Test of Detonation ZND Theory with Experimental Data of TNT

Abstract:A two-phase repellent-translation equation of state of explosive detonation product (two-phase R-TEOS) was obtained. Using the two-phase R-TEOS and a known isentropic through the CJ point of an explosive as reference curve, the detonation parameters for various densities of the explosive can be estimated. The comparing the experiment data of detonation velocity for various initial density values of TNT which detonation product contains more solid carbon with the theory values estimated with above mentioned method, a new test of the hypotheses of the ZND theory was performed. The experiment and theory values of detonation velocity for various density values (from1.632 g/cm3to 0.901 g/cm3) are in good agreement, and their average relative difference is only 0.60%. The conclusion was drawn again that the hypotheses of the the ZND theory of detonation are true, and the two-phase R-TEOS is a proper equation of state of detonation product.
